Mr. Austermühle is the Executive Director of the Peruvian conservation NGO Mundo Azul as well as the new Peruvian NGP, INECI (Interamerican Institute for Integral Ecology). He has had 29 years of experience in leadership positions in environmental and marine conservation and research in both Germany and Peru. He is also General Manager of the Peruvian marine ecotourism operator, Nature Expeditions, with 11 years of experience in tourism. He is a leading marine conservationist who has exposed the extent of the illegal dolphin hunt in Peru where thousands of dolphins are killed each year and sold illegally or used as shark bait.
